James Talarico To Run For New House District 50 in 2022

“Republicans have gerrymandered me out of my district,” said Rep. Talarico in a tweet. “If they think they can keep me off the House floor, they better think again.”

Democratic State Rep. James Talarico currently represents District 52, around Round Rock, but the new redistricting schemes have changed his district so much now is set up to favor the Republicans.

Talarico’s campaign already has some of the biggest names in the democratic party backing it up, including Beto O’Rourke, Wendy Davis, Lina Hidalgo, and Joaquin Castro to name a few.

Talarico added he was not mad at the Republicans for proposing a district that favored them, but he did condemn the way they did it, “trying to get rid of me by dividing the communities of color in my district.”
